In the U.S., fires caused by electrical distribution (things like electrical wiring, cords, plugs and lights) or lighting killed 430 people per year from 2015 to 2019, according to the National Fire Protection Association (NFPA). Common signs of an electrical fire can include charred or blackened electrical outlets and switches, flickering or blinking lights, sparks or smoke coming from outlets, a sizzling sound coming from an outlet, or even an outlet or wall that feels unusually hot to the touch.
